Top Trails to Hike in Yosemite National Park.
On your next trip to Yosemite have a list of hikes to do ranging from easy to hard so you can spend less time looking at All Trails app and more time actually on the Trails!
Vernal And Nevada Falls Via Mist Trail: 6.4 miles, rated as Hard with 2,208 ft of elevation gain. You can also take just the Vernal Falls trail and cut the distance in half at 3.1 miles. Scenery: Waterfalls and Creeks along Granite.
Upper Yosemite Falls Trail: Featured in the image -> This trail is 6.6 miles and is rated Hard with 3000 ft of elevation gain.
Scenery: Half Dome, Waterfalls, and Yosemite Valley.
Lower Yosemite Falls Trail: 1.2 miles and rated as easy. This Trail features a swimming area underneath a waterfall.
Mirror Lake Via Valley Loop Trail: 4.4 miles and rated as Moderate. This Trail features an alpine lake nestled in the Granite peaks with Wildflowers.
Horsetail Fall & the Firefall Phenomenon: 4 miles, in late February when the sun hits the falls right, it appears like molten lava cascading down the side of the cliff.
